From 264fb1570d14a52f0e8163dbdbb86d47fc188c84 Mon Sep 17 00:00:00 2001 From: Matt Date: Thu, 16 Jul 2020 16:18:01 -0700 Subject: [PATCH] Add default reflective pipeline (#35) --- .../org/photonvision/vision/processes/PipelineManager.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/photon-server/src/main/java/org/photonvision/vision/processes/PipelineManager.java b/photon-server/src/main/java/org/photonvision/vision/processes/PipelineManager.java index 96318aa31..36e517e72 100644 --- a/photon-server/src/main/java/org/photonvision/vision/processes/PipelineManager.java +++ b/photon-server/src/main/java/org/photonvision/vision/processes/PipelineManager.java @@ -55,7 +55,9 @@ public class PipelineManager { * @param userPipelines Pipelines to add to the manager. */ public PipelineManager(List userPipelines) { - this.userPipelineSettings = userPipelines; + this.userPipelineSettings = new ArrayList<>(userPipelines); + + if (userPipelines.size() < 1) addPipeline(PipelineType.Reflective); } /**